Chipotle Cilantro Lime Rice

A zesty and aromatic rice side dish featuring fresh cilantro and lime juice, perfect for tacos, burrito bowls, and grilled meats.

Ingredients
  

Main
  • 1 cup white rice
  • 2 cups water
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 clove garlic minced
  • Salt to taste
  • 2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
  • 1/4 cup fresh cilantro chopped

Method
 

  1. Rinse the rice under cold water until the water runs clear.
  2. In a medium saucepan, heat the olive oil over medium heat and add the minced garlic; s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ant, avoiding browning.
  3. Stir in the rinsed rice to coat with oil and garlic, then pour in the water and add salt to taste (about 1/2 teaspoon).
  4. Increase heat to high and bring the mixture to a boil.
  5. Once boiling, reduce heat to low, cover with a tight-fitting lid, and simmer for 18–20 minutes until the water is absorbed.
  6. Remove the saucepan from heat and let it sit covered for 5 minutes to steam.
  7. Fluff the rice with a fork, then add the fresh lime juice and chopped cilantro, folding gently to combine.
  8. Transfer the rice to a large serving bowl and serve warm.

Notes

Use freshly squeezed lime juice for best flavor and substitute brown rice if preferred (increase cooking time).
